Bank of America Lowers Concentrix (NASDAQ:CNXC) Price Target to $61.00

Concentrix logo with Business Services background

Concentrix (NASDAQ:CNXC - Get Free Report) had its target price decreased by analysts at Bank of America from $65.00 to $61.00 in a research note issued on Friday,Benzinga reports. The brokerage presently has a "neutral" rating on the stock. Bank of America's price target points to a potential upside of 15.40% from the company's current price.

Other analysts have also recently issued research reports about the stock. Barrington Research reissued an "outperform" rating and set a $54.00 price target on shares of Concentrix in a research report on Tuesday, June 24th. Wall Street Zen lowered Concentrix from a "buy" rating to a "hold" rating in a research report on Saturday, June 21st. Finally, Robert W. Baird raised their price target on Concentrix from $62.00 to $72.00 and gave the stock an "outperform" rating in a report on Thursday. Two investment analysts have rated the stock with a hold rating, three have given a buy rating and one has given a strong buy rating to the company. According to data from MarketBeat, Concentrix presently has a consensus rating of "Moderate Buy" and a consensus price target of $66.75.

Concentrix Trading Up 2.2%

Concentrix stock traded up $1.15 during midday trading on Friday, hitting $52.86. 892,875 shares of the stock were exchanged, compared to its average volume of 834,832. The company has a current ratio of 1.61, a quick ratio of 1.65 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.14. The stock has a market capitalization of $3.38 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 14.52, a PEG ratio of 0.67 and a beta of 0.56. The stock's 50-day simple moving average is $53.86 and its 200 day simple moving average is $49.54. Concentrix has a fifty-two week low of $36.28 and a fifty-two week high of $77.00.

Concentrix (NASDAQ:CNXC -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, June 26th. The company reported $2.70 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ing analysts' consensus estimates of $2.76 by ($0.06). The firm had revenue of $2.42 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$2.38 billion. Concentrix had a return on equity of 16.31% and a net margin of 2.54%. The firm's quarterly revenue was up 1.5%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ter in the prior year, the business earned $2.69 EPS. On average, equities analysts anticipate that Concentrix will post 10.11 EPS for the current year.

About Concentrix

(Get Free Report)

Concentrix Corporation engages in the provision of technology-infused customer experience (CX) solutions worldwide. The company provides CX process optimization, technology innovation, front- and back-office automation, analytics, and business transformation services, across various channels of communication, such as voice, chat, email, social media, asynchronous messaging, and custom applications.
